} // Добавление визуального редактора $editor_cell = array('anons', 'text', 'text2', 'text3', 'text4', 'text5', 'full_text'); } // подключение файла модуля if (is_file(DOC . 'modules/' . $action . '/admin/' . $module_do . '.php')) { require DOC . 'modules/' . $action . '/admin/' . $module_do . '.php'; } // Обработчик Добавления/обновления записей в таблице if (Text::get_post('send') != '') { if ($id == 0) { // Добавление записи в таблицу $new_id = $object->setRow($table); } else { // Редактирование записи $object->editRow($table, $id); clearCacheFiles($smarty, 0, $table, $id); if ($table == 'catalog_groups') { $query = 'CALL catalog_groups_update_links_after_update(:id)'; $params = array(':id' => $id); PdoWrap::execute($query, $params); } } $errors = $object->getErrors(); // Редирект if (!isset($errors['all']) || $errors['all'] === false) { location($__return); } } // Выгрузка переменных в шаблон $smarty->assign('data', $data);